Arabo-Friesians are not just

simple crosses

between Friesians and Arabians. They should carry around 10% selected desert Arabian blood and look like

pure friesians

, with slightly less fetlock hair and finer heads. They have smooth gaits and enjoy moving.

Why are Friesians always black?


Friesians:

Pure black is typically preferred for the Friesian breed , so most Friesian registries do not allow horses with

excessive white markings

to be registered. Registries consider most white markings as evidence that the horse is not a pure bred Friesian.

Why did Friesians almost go extinct?


Friesians:

The Friesian nearly became extinct in the 1900s when the market for multi-purpose horses disappeared By the middle of the 1900s, the population stood at about 500.

White Friesians: Are there white Friesians

Can Friesians be white? Purebred Friesian horses cannot be white In 2007 a white Friesian horse showed at Equitana. This horse, Nero, was actually 25% Arabian, 75% Friesian.

Can you jump a Friesian?


Friesian:

A. Friesian horses are very versatile and can be used in riding for pleasure and in competition, for dressage, driving for pleasure and in competition and even for light farm work. Unlike some other European warmbloods, Friesians have not been bred as jumpers , although some owners enjoy jumping their horses.

Friesian Horses: Why are Friesian horses short lived

Friesian horses die younger than most other horses. This has been a problem for breeders for years, but do you know why they have such a short lifespan. Friesians die young because breeders decreased bloodlines through selective breeding.
